P Martin-Dupont is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, P Martin-Dupont has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 893 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Pharmacology, 2 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 2 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in P Martin-Dupont's work include Urinary Tract Infections Management (2 papers),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(2 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(2 papers). P Martin-Dupont is often cited by papers focused on Urinary Tract Infections Management (2 papers), Renal Transplantation Outcomes and Treatments (2 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(2 papers).
